CVE-2023-5088

Опубликовано: 18 фев. 2026
Источник: msrc
CVSS3: 6.4
EPSS Низкий

Описание

Qemu: improper ide controller reset can lead to mbr overwrite

A bug in QEMU could cause a guest I/O operation otherwise addressed to an arbitrary disk offset to be targeted to offset 0 instead (potentially overwriting the VM's boot code). This could be used, for example, by L2 guests with a virtual disk (vdiskL2) stored on a virtual disk of an L1 (vdiskL1) hypervisor to read and/or write data to LBA 0 of vdiskL1, potentially gaining control of L1 at its next reboot.
